Novel method to synthesize ordered mesoporous silica with high surface areas
چکیده انگلیسی

SBA-15 type ordered mesoporous silicas with high surface areas and mesopore volumes have been obtained using H3PO4 as catalyst during the synthesis process. Moreover, the surfactant removal process has been optimized to enhance the textural properties of the resulting materials. Therefore, silica-based ordered mesoporous materials exhibiting surface areas more than twice larger than those of conventional SBA-15 are reported. Additionally, the incorporation of phosphorous centers into the silica framework has been achieved using high amounts of H3PO4 as catalyst during the synthesis process. This textural properties' enhancement makes these materials excellent candidates to be used in several scientific and technological research areas, where high surface areas and mesopore volumes are required.
